COVID-19: 21 cops posted in Kulgam test positive | KNO

Kulgam, May 21 (KNO): At least 21 cops who are posted in Kulgam district have been tested positive for Covid-19 on Thursday, officials said here.  A senior police official told news agency—Kashmir News Observer (KNO), that 21 cops who are posted at Reserve camp in higher secondary school Chawalgam have been tested positive for COVID-19 “They are posted at HSS Chawalgam from last 3 months and not in DPL Kulgam.” He further added that one cop among the reserve company was tested positive few days ago after which samples of all cops posted there were taken. Pertinently, around 80 policemen have been tested positive for Covid-19 in Kashmir division so far—(KNO)
